My client is seeking an experienced Deputy Manager to support the Registered Manager in the opening and running of a new 2bed EBD home located in Derby. At the home they prioritise exceptional care and strive to create a nurturing environment where every child can thrive.

Responsibilities:

  • Assist the Manager in overseeing the daily operations of the Home
  • Provide leadership and guidance to staff members
  • Ensure highquality care is provided to our young people
  • Supervise and train staff in line with children's home regulations
  • Manage and administer medications as needed
  • Collaborate with healthcare professionals to develop and implement care plans
  • Maintain accurate records and documentation of resident care
  • Ensure compliance with all regulatory guidelines and standards

Qualifications:

  • Previous experience in a senior care or assisted living setting working with children
  • Strong leadership skills with the ability to supervise and motivate a team
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Ability to multitask and prioritise responsibilities effectively
  • Attention to detail and strong organisational skills
  • Level 34 or 5 in Health and Social Care
